The Sketchbook Project

The sketchbook project, created by Art House Co-op, is an exhibit of thousands of sketchbooks submitted by artists from 94 countries. While the project is no longer accepting submissions, it will go on tour in March to cities across the U.S. including Brooklyn, Austin and Chicago. All sketchbooks are Moleskin, given to each artist to send back full of their creativity. Each book is then given a barcode so the artist can track the book and find it in its final resting place, the Brooklyn Art Library.
